Abstract:

In 2004, the Flexible Learning Advisory Group (FLAG) began a project entitled 'Preparing the ground' to identify performance indicators that could be used to assess the uptake, use and impact of e-learning in Australian vocational education and training (VET). The project examined documents prepared by or for national, state and territory training agencies, public and private training providers, VET and e-learning researchers, and international education and training agencies. It identified more than 200 such indicators and selected 12 indicators as key measures of the uptake of e-learning in VET and outcomes from e-learning for VET clients and providers. This paper lists the 200 indicators identified by the project as a reference for organisations wanting to better understand e-learning outcomes. The indicators are presented under six broad headings: uptake of e-learning by VET clients; uptake of e-learning by VET providers; uptake of e-learning by the VET system; outcomes of e-learning for VET clients; outcomes of e-learning for VET providers; and outcomes of e-learning for the VET system. Within each group, the indicators are sorted by common themes and move progressively from generic to more specific measurement.
